#a96d63 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#a96d63 is composed of 66.3% red, 42.7% green and 38.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 35.5% magenta, 41.4% yellow and 33.7% black. It has a hue angle of 8.6 degrees, a saturation of 28.9% and a lightness of 52.5%. #a96d63 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ffdac6 with #530000. Closest websafe color is: #996666.

Shades and Tints of #a96d63

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080505 is the darkest color, while #fdfbfb is the lightest one.

Tones of #a96d63

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8d817f is the less saturated color, while #fd310f is the most saturated one.
